I should have added that both of my cars were very good, with my Q4 in mod being one of the best runs I have ever had in mod 1/12. I ended up qualifying 3rd on a 53/8:06 to Keven's 54/8:04, which is the closest I think I have ever been. Unfortunately I made the car a bit too aggressive for the main so I had to spend the first half puckered, babying the car around - but it all worked out.
I finished 3rd overall in Mod 1/12 and 5th overall in 13.5 1/12th. The 13.5 car scrubbed a bit too much on the sweeper but was otherwise very good, too! Again, let me know if you have any questions.
